I was surprised at how much air this little fan was putting through on my CR-10S Pro V2, but even more surprised at how loud it is. I was trying to replace an already loud stock hotend fan on this printer so went with this one, but it is just too ridiculously loud and has a little "whine" to the noise as well. Going to go with a Noctua next time, I think.

Definitely pumps out the air….. but 25db?I just tested and it’s easily double that. 52db on my meter in a quiet room. Will Run it anyway as im tired of replacing cheaper fans that create issues. Still quieter than the stock fan.

I placed this onto the motherboard fan slot of one of my Ender 3 printers as a test to see if I wanted to swap them all over. The good news is that it moves a lot of air - definitely more than the factory fan it is replacing. However it came at a cost of actually increasing the volume/noise level instead of decreasing it as expected. This fan is not as quiet as the stated dB spec and therefore not worth the very premium price.

Very quiet fan that seems to blow a lot of air. Perfect fit for my Ender 3. Keep in mind there are only bare leads on this fan so you will need to either crimp the connector or solder pre-made ones onto the end. This fan is a perfect 24v replacement for the 24v motherboard fan on the Ender 3.
